ArduCAM RaspberryPi 项目常见问题解决方案

ArduCAM RaspberryPi 项目常见问题解决方案

项目基础介绍

ArduCAM RaspberryPi 项目是一个开源项目,主要用于在 Raspberry Pi 平台上使用 Arducam 相机进行开发和演示。该项目提供了多种示例代码和工具,帮助开发者快速上手并实现各种相机功能。项目的主要编程语言是 C/C++,同时也包含一些 Python 脚本用于辅助功能。

新手使用注意事项及解决方案

1. 依赖库安装问题

问题描述:新手在尝试运行项目时,可能会遇到依赖库未安装或版本不匹配的问题,导致编译失败。

解决步骤

  1. 检查依赖库:首先,确保所有必要的依赖库已安装。常见的依赖库包括 libopencv-devlibv4l-dev 等。
  2. 更新包管理器:使用 sudo apt-get update 更新包管理器,确保可以获取最新的软件包。
  3. 安装依赖库:使用 sudo apt-get install <依赖库名称> 安装缺失的依赖库。
  4. 版本检查:如果项目文档中指定了特定版本的依赖库,请确保安装的版本与项目要求一致。

2. 硬件连接问题

问题描述:新手在连接 Arducam 相机到 Raspberry Pi 时,可能会遇到硬件连接不稳定或无法识别相机的问题。

解决步骤

  1. 检查连接:确保相机与 Raspberry Pi 的连接牢固,特别是 CSI 接口的连接。
  2. 供电检查:确保 Raspberry Pi 和相机的供电充足,避免因供电不足导致的连接问题。
  3. 驱动加载:在终端中运行 ls /dev/video* 检查相机设备是否被正确识别。如果没有显示相机设备,尝试重新启动 Raspberry Pi。
  4. 固件更新:如果相机仍然无法识别,尝试更新 Raspberry Pi 的固件和相机驱动。

3. 编译和运行示例代码问题

问题描述:新手在编译和运行项目提供的示例代码时,可能会遇到编译错误或运行时错误。

解决步骤

  1. 检查编译环境:确保已安装必要的编译工具,如 gccmake 等。
  2. 编译示例代码:进入示例代码目录,运行 make 命令进行编译。如果遇到编译错误,根据错误提示进行修正。
  3. 运行示例代码:编译成功后,运行生成的可执行文件。如果运行时出现错误,检查是否有未满足的依赖或硬件问题。
  4. 调试信息:使用 gdb 或其他调试工具,查看详细的错误信息,帮助定位问题。

通过以上步骤,新手可以更好地理解和解决在使用 ArduCAM RaspberryPi 项目时遇到的问题。

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值